A noveloxidative (3 + 3) cycloaddition/ring-opening reaction of N,N '-cyclic azomethine imines withthe in situ generated diaza-oxylallyl cations from simple urea derivativesin the presence of base and PhI(OAc)(2) has been developed.This transformation performs well over a broad substrate scope, whichprovides facile and rapid access to 1,2,3,5-tetrazine-4(1H)-one derivatives in good yields.
